Transaction 56f7693c73b59b3616af14d39d347dacb9c9f56c28e5ae8457905e456b5e67fc
1 Input
2 Outputs
- 56f7693c73b59b3616af14d39d347dacb9c9f56c28e5ae8457905e456b5e67fc:0
- 56f7693c73b59b3616af14d39d347dacb9c9f56c28e5ae8457905e456b5e67fc:1
value 439488
address 1GA4aJhGM9oUpA4tJoqyH2NNgdY8TvTPf2
value 6234681
address 13hZD3s3efJ3uETmpifWDnhRLB6vfZYMx4